What Is Grain Shrink?

Grain shrink refers to the difference between expected grain inventory and actual grain inventory over time. Shrink can occur for many reasons, including moisture changes, handling losses, measurement inconsistencies, delayed inventory updates, ticketing errors, or inventory reconciliation problems.

In many facilities, grain shrink is not caused by a single issue. Instead, it often results from multiple operational gaps across receiving, ticketing, inventory management, and accounting workflows.

These operational gaps may include:

  • Manual grain ticketing
  • Delayed inventory updates
  • Disconnected software systems
  • Inconsistent grain movement tracking
  • Limited reporting visibility
  • Data entry errors
  • Delayed reconciliation processes
  • Lack of real-time inventory visibility

Improving grain inventory tracking helps facilities identify where discrepancies occur so teams can respond more quickly and maintain better operational visibility.

Inventory Reconciliation Plays a Major Role in Shrink Management

Inventory reconciliation is one of the most important processes for identifying grain shrink and maintaining operational accuracy.

When reconciliation workflows are delayed or heavily manual, facilities may spend additional time identifying where discrepancies originated.

Grain accounting reconciliation often involves comparing:

  • Scale ticket data
  • Inventory records
  • Settlement activity
  • Storage balances
  • Movement records
  • Contract fulfillment data
